Plumbing concerns adhere to the age of the neighborhood. In pre-war homes near King Road, original cast iron can be harsh inside, like sandpaper to grease and dust. Those pipes were indicated for a various age of soaps and water usage. Over time, internal scaling tightens the diameter, and every bit of caked fat or coffee ground has more places to catch. Farther west toward Academy Roadway and Beauregard, post-war residential properties commonly have a mix of materials, with clay or Orangeburg sewer laterals that have actually lived past their convenience zone. Clay sections shift at joints and welcome hairline root breach. The roots thrive where grass watering and structure plantings maintain the dirt damp.
On top of products and age, Alexandria sees large swings between saturating storms and dry spells. After hefty rainfall, sump pumps push even more water towards main lines, and any type of weak point in a sewage system comes to be noticeable. During cold wave, oil in kitchen area runs comes to be a ceraceous cork. The city's slim alleys and shared easements complicate accessibility. An expert drain cleaning company that works below frequently learns to stage devices with minimal impact, coordinate with neighbors for cleanout access, and prepare for the old-house peculiarities that do not show up in a textbook.

After the walk-through, the work divides right into access, diagnosis, and removal. Access relies on the component and where the clog is, yet cleanouts are the best beginning factor. If a home does not have usable cleanouts, it could require drawing a toilet or eliminating a trap. For diagnosis, specialists rely upon 2 devices as a standard: a cable television machine and a cam. The cable television determines whether the line is openable. The electronic camera reveals why it got obstructed and whether the piping itself is sound.
Cable work has its very own skill. On a kitchen line, wire option issues because soft wires puncture through grease and afterwards "cork-screw" it without scratching a clean path. A stiffer cable with an effectively sized blade tends to cut rather than poke holes, which means the line remains clear much longer. In actors iron, oscillating and step-by-step ahead pressure prevents gouging an already slim wall. In clay laterals with roots, you do not wish to ram the cable so hard that it widens a joint. The objective is controlled reducing, not brute force.
Once flow is brought back, the camera tells the truth. I have actually found offsets that just block when a washing maker discharges at full speed, and stomaches that hold simply adequate water to catch paper for weeks. Without an electronic camera, you may believe the obstruction is random and brace for the next one. With video, you recognize whether you require a repair service, a hydro jetting service, or simply much better habits.
Clogged drains pipes are not a single group. Hair in a bathtub waste needs a different touch than lint arrested around burrs in a 1950s galvanized arm. Basic hair blockages reply to hands-on extraction and a short cord run. If the bathtub has an old trip-lever setting up with a corroded spring, that mechanism might be the genuine trouble, capturing hair like a rake. Changing the assembly while the line is open protects against the repeat call.
Kitchen sinks are the war zone. Modern recipe soaps cut oil better than they used to, yet cooking oils and starchy foods still adhesive themselves to the pipeline walls. Do it yourself enzyme products have their area for maintenance, but they can not dig deep into solidified fats that have actually cooled and layered. On a grease line, a two-step method functions best: mechanical reducing to regain flow, after that a regulated warm water flush to rinse suspended fats downstream. If the oil expands into the main, or if the buildup is heavy and split, hydro jetting becomes a smarter selection than repeated cabling.
Toilets offer their very own puzzles. A single clog after an unadvised flush of wipes is one point. Repetitive obstructions point to a catch design concern, an underpowered flush, or a partial obstruction past the closet bend. I have actually discovered toy dinosaurs wedged past the catch, unidentified to the homeowner, that only created troubles when paper stuck behind them. A video camera with a small head can slip past the toilet flange after drawing the component, and that five-minute look can save you replacing a whole bathroom that is blameless.
Basement flooring drains pipes and washing standpipes commonly mislead. When both backup, many people presume the primary drain is blocked. In some cases that is true. Other times a check valve has actually fallen short, or a standpipe is undersized for a high-efficiency washer that dumps a rise. A major drain cleaning service tests fixtures one at a time, enjoys circulations, and correlates the timing of back-ups. If the line holds during low-flow components however burps throughout a washing machine cycle, capacity, not outright clog, is your villain.
Hydro jetting makes use of high-pressure water, typically between 1,500 and 4,000 PSI, supplied with a hose pipe with a specialized nozzle. The water cuts oil and combs the pipeline wall, and the rear jets draw the pipe onward while purging debris back to the cleanout. For heavy grease and split range, it is much more efficient than cabling due to the fact that it cleans up the full area of the pipeline. In root-invaded clay laterals, a root-cutting nozzle opens the line extra evenly than a spiral blade that can leave whiskers to capture paper.
Jetting brings its very own guidelines. Pipe condition dictates stress and nozzle choice. In fragile actors iron with apparent thinning, utilize reduced pressure and a spinning nozzle that brightens as opposed to chisels. In newer PVC, higher pressure with a warthog or similar nozzle gets rid of sludge quick without danger. A seasoned technology evaluates how drain cleaning in Alexandria quickly the line is removing by the feeling of the hose pipe, the audio of return water, and the debris leaving the cleanout. If sand or accumulation pours out, you might be managing a damaged pipeline or a collapsed section, and every min of jetting must be stabilized versus the risk of cleaning a lot more bed linens away.
The ideal usage situation for hydro jetting in Alexandria is the kitchen-to-main run in older homes, the primary drain with scale and paper hang-ups, and business lines that see consistent food waste. Dining Establishments on Mount Vernon Opportunity know the rhythm: quarterly jetting keeps solution continuous. For a house owner with reoccuring kitchen area sink back-ups every three months, a single jetting usually resets the clock for a year or even more, supplied the line is audio and the household stays clear of dumping oil down the drain.
Sewer cleaning is about restoring circulation, however that does not mean giving up the backyard or the sidewalk. Alexandria's slim lots typically hide the drain lateral under garden beds and rock pathways. A thoughtful sewer cleaning service stages pipes and devices to protect plantings and avoids unnecessary excavation. Start with every accessible cleanout. If the property lacks one near the front, it may be worth setting up a new cleanout at the residential property line. That single renovation can transform a half-day battle into a one-hour maintenance job.
Cabling a sewage system ought to be a measured procedure. If roots exist, a collection of gradually larger blades is far better than jumping to the maximum dimension and chewing the joint right into an irregular birthed. Electronic camera inspection after the first pass informs you where the roots are going into. Numerous Alexandria laterals have a short clay sector from your house to the sidewalk, then a PVC substitute to the city main. The shift is where roots get into. As soon as you recognize the exact area, you can reduce cleanly and discuss whether a place fixing, lining, or proceeded upkeep makes sense.
Grease in a sewer is much less common for single-family homes, yet multi-unit buildings and residential or commercial properties with basement kitchens see it more. Jetting excels right here, with a final pass of warm water to carry the slurry downstream. If multiple devices contribute to the line, the routine matters as long as the technique. Collaborating a building-wide cooking area time out throughout the solution avoids fresh discharge from relocating grease into a freshly cleaned up segment.
Not every problem justifies immediate replacement. I lug a set of instances in my head from work where persistence and upkeep functioned far better than a rush to dig. A home owner on a tree-lined street had roots at a single joint, 6 feet from the aesthetic. We cut them tidy, jetted the line, and saw a minor offset on electronic camera without much soil noticeable. Instead of trench a rock walkway and interfere with the well-known boxwoods, we scheduled origin cutting every 12 to 18 months and fed a small dose of root control foam after the spring growth flush. That was 8 years back. The sidewalk is undamaged, and overall upkeep costs still sit below the cost of excavation by a broad margin.
On the other hand, I have seen tummies that hold two inches of water over a lengthy stretch. Cam video reveals paper sitting in the dip, relocating just with heavy circulations. In those instances, no quantity of jetting adjustments the geometry. You can preserve around a stomach, but you will live with periodic stagnations and more stringent regulations about what decreases. If the stomach rests under a driveway slated for resurfacing, work with the repair service with the paving. You just wish to dig deep into once.

Think of cabling as the scalpel, jetting as the scrub brush with pressure, and repair work as the reconstruction. Cabling is specific for difficult blockages, origins, and localized obstructions. Jetting excels at full-pipe cleaning, oil, sludge, and range. Fixing or lining addresses geometry troubles, damaged segments, and significant intrusions.
If your primary has a solitary origin intrusion at a joint and the pipeline is or else solid, cabling followed by root-specific jetting provides you clean wall surfaces and a longer interval in between sees. If your kitchen line is slow monthly and the electronic camera reveals hefty oil lengthwise, jetting deserves the financial investment. If the electronic camera shows a collapse, a deep tummy, or a significant balanced out, miss duplicated cleaning and price the repair work. In Alexandria, many laterals are superficial near the house and deeper near the curb. Locating the problem could expose a repair only three feet deep close to the front steps, not a ten-foot dig in the street.

On a row of 1920s block homes near Braddock Road, 3 neighbors called within two months with the very same problem: slow-moving first-floor commodes, gurgling tub drains, and periodic basement floor drain moisture after storms. The common element was a clay section right before the city main, invaded by origins. Each home had a different design, but the video camera informed the same story. The first house owner went with biannual root cutting. The second chose hydro jetting plus a foam root therapy. The third set up an area repair before an intended patio area remodelling. A year commercial sewer cleaning later on, all three continued to be delighted, each with a solution matched to their budget and tolerance for recurring maintenance.
In a split-level west of Ft Ward, a household battled with a cooking area line that blocked every six weeks. The run took a trip with an ended up ceiling and transformed twice before going down to the main. Cord passes opened up flow, yet grease returned rapidly. We jetted the line with a little spinning nozzle at modest pressure, after that purged with hot water and degreaser. The cam revealed a clean, brilliant inside. We relocated the air admission shutoff to enhance venting, which minimized the sink's sluggishness. With nothing else changed, they went eighteen months prior to the following service phone call, and that one was for a washroom sink catch, not the residential sewer cleaning Alexandria kitchen.

Chemical drain cleaners can damage pipes, especially older metal or PVC plumbing. They often fail to fully remove clogs and instead push debris deeper. Repeated use can cause corrosion, leaks, and pipe failure. They also pose safety risks due to toxic fumes and chemical burns.

Plumbers use tools such as drain snakes, augers, and hydro jetting systems. They may inspect the drain with a camera to locate the blockage. The method chosen depends on clog type, pipe material, and drain location. The goal is to fully remove debris without damaging pipes.
Drains should only need unclogging when signs of blockage appear. Preventive cleaning is typically recommended every 1โ2 years for high-use drains. Homes with older plumbing or frequent clogs may need more frequent service. Regular maintenance helps avoid emergencies.
Plumbers mechanically break up or flush out the blockage using professional equipment. Snaking cuts through debris, while hydro jetting uses high-pressure water to clean pipe walls. Camera inspections help confirm the clog is fully cleared. The approach depends on severity and drain type.
Wet wipes should never be flushed, even if labeled โflushable,โ because they do not break down properly. Grease or oils should also never be flushed, as they harden and cause blockages. These items commonly lead to sewer backups. Toilets are designed only for human waste and toilet paper.
Hot water can help dissolve grease or soap buildup in minor clogs. It is most effective when combined with dish soap. It will not clear solid obstructions or severe blockages. Boiling water can damage PVC pipes if used improperly.
